Ethical expectations: Hospitality industry standards versus student responses.
- 155 p.
Source: Masters Abstracts International, Volume: 32-06, page: 1497.
Thesis (M.S.)--Eastern Michigan University, 1994.
Ethics in business practices and personal behavior are important in the hospitality industry in areas such as sexual harassment, internal theft and truth-in-menu legislation. Are hospitality management students prepared ethically to assume management positions? Students' ethical perceptions were compared to standards of hospitality organizations as interpreted by industry managers. The Hospitality Ethics Scenarios survey was administered to students (n = 45) and managers (n = 52) representing various industry segments. Statistical analysis of one of eleven dilemmas indicated that managers had higher ethical perception than undergraduates. Students with less classroom and work experience did not score lower than more experienced students. The qualitative data suggested a wide range of ethical perception among students and managers but also suggested that these two groups were similar. Students had difficulty recognizing ethical dilemmas and were unable to recall discussion of ethical issues in class, suggesting relevant ethical issues should be presented and noted specifically across the curriculum.Subjects--Topical Terms:
